From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-wr1-x42b.google.com (mail-wr1-x42b.google.com [IPv6:2a00:1450:4864:20::42b]) by sourceware.org (Postfix) with ESMTPS id F3A543858D1E for ; Sat, 30 Mar 2024 13:04:09 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org F3A543858D1E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=gmail.com ARC-Filter: OpenARC Filter v1.0.0 sourceware.org F3A543858D1E Authentication-Results: server2.sourceware.org; arc=none smtp.remote-ip=2a00:1450:4864:20::42b ARC-Seal: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1711803852; cv=none; b=V9pSZ/0ZfC/sNCGya6WESu81mo1mYYXe1u0+7xCNjUKH4CyOfp0CSotNcDE5BFmUHzaVJEMHo1JSKkz3zmumEWls0OQzL4195QL2zCS1DAoBFMB96L7bg3IxYkzHBAxdpw5Qw67RbQDa7kN0XJG1jpHB2IwC1L0xXVTFPy5BDZY= ARC-Message-Signature: i=1; a=rsa-sha256; d=sourceware.org; s=key; t=1711803852; c=relaxed/simple; bh=lR97++EnBd5R6bPifqnU+Rva5SyzVpb7L1cfvH5m9/g=; h=DKIM-Signature:From:To:Subject:Date:Message-ID:MIME-Version; b=J7/c8eouWy5StiCgeeGa9VUUc+Vq9cOsuY5fBPYDQAO7GGWRQDIVXWAOxxu8gqIj1Dnqr/b6QpQIne24nUcxknYyn/OeuvZLgHO+wYPTP96pZoZho4YVzCa6n0C5QvPg4plg//k7uRJWgxNr9fljmDumPNQFPK8foIu+uGOvwpQ= ARC-Authentication-Results: i=1; server2.sourceware.org Received: by mail-wr1-x42b.google.com with SMTP id ffacd0b85a97d-341730bfc46so1950599f8f.3 for ; Sat, 30 Mar 2024 06:04:09 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1711803848; x=1712408648; darn=gcc.gnu.org; h=mime-version:user-agent:message-id:in-reply-to:date:references :subject:cc:to:from:from:to:cc:subject:date:message-id:reply-to; bh=gAmx7p36ActSMdc03RQvAkxSce+XLZKD4hPfKJTr0KE=; b=Tmsk4a6hCp52+lvEi+g06VewQY12Z1a1bAiO67HQ+2of7YtLrUdB3CxWChq0wsymSB xEQvQ6PEin3eOixD4qqAm1Wgxa2E9t4DCQYdDMWokaT0F1ipeRUiYUyb/EzDCd/Wag/G zk7UkJmzl9lxtuHIW3I9OmRUkY0HXZ4xydsKngJ0SdNYC/RwKBvC1kjP7anxcMd/gzUY tO1a7FA86VNnLa+RDrh6KY+az/sBvkgB82n597ASWNCiyyK1S6o67J1dDUph4ndT+CMT ww45ZICewIBcInacCY76FnExN4XX7NnH87U9bWrh9uV550AUunO+F0aptQI/7sI81Sxr 8gSQ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1711803848; x=1712408648; h=mime-version:user-agent:message-id:in-reply-to:date:references :subject:cc:to:from:x-gm-message-state:from:to:cc:subject:date :message-id:reply-to; bh=gAmx7p36ActSMdc03RQvAkxSce+XLZKD4hPfKJTr0KE=; b=sDKLOrK8LPMj9FGNAqRVD7cCxeCltCGOBTx3C6uCiMz5IQsWzlK0MlnlQM0Lfu+krh orvxb5gg73sDQKpJr4f00ORrTx/VFsPdPO/rMcfpd2Huf2yCfE70LMWrq+7zvGU7fop8 iASO0ThLUHI4YS8sIfVczsHBasZYSNN7ONCRPmmV354ipeknpVqskULGdir6d/A2X9NQ bU5Nl6/zIU3Aj46oKBotaW5+KFlYy0RmQrUHBicZZx776NsltE67buot7ownhG4YIxMx AismnN4GD8n4+x/V/fKCreUGICmn2rgkC8WGKDqsZgfNwKj4GMlLPY/CyAA1mU3TQZe8 a5yw== X-Gm-Message-State: AOJu0YyG/Rlx7/HGaZooKfEy8r7zjO5/PfIUcK4NiVpm8ekBNY4KK32+ kbns1psMdeFLj/fJcL0mI2UgpH3vi2NOAU2cnB2KEBF0qNqR41mt X-Google-Smtp-Source: AGHT+IFhls30MRIOMHyh0a3bmLUF6MRYSxu7E8GJ6kcKKuBrocEb3Zf3xSctfekzdSOsncP78lF1Ew== X-Received: by 2002:adf:fa8f:0:b0:33d:a011:ae42 with SMTP id h15-20020adffa8f000000b0033da011ae42mr3341871wrr.38.1711803848210; Sat, 30 Mar 2024 06:04:08 -0700 (PDT) Received: from lancelot ([91.84.105.30]) by smtp.gmail.com with ESMTPSA id ce8-20020a5d5e08000000b003433e4c6d43sm2751830wrb.32.2024.03.30.06.04.07 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 30 Mar 2024 06:04:07 -0700 (PDT) Received: from gaius by lancelot with local (Exim 4.96) (envelope-from ) id 1rqYNS-000GHr-2I; Sat, 30 Mar 2024 13:04:06 +0000 From: Gaius Mulley To: Christophe Lyon Cc: gcc-patches@gcc.gnu.org Subject: Re: [PATCH 1/2] modula2: Add m2.install-html rule to gcc/m2/Make-lang.in References: <20240329180903.3325518-1-christophe.lyon@linaro.org> Date: Sat, 30 Mar 2024 13:04:06 +0000 In-Reply-To: <20240329180903.3325518-1-christophe.lyon@linaro.org> (Christophe Lyon's message of "Fri, 29 Mar 2024 18:09:02 +0000") Message-ID: <8734s7q3ax.fsf@localhost> User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.2 (gnu/linux) MIME-Version: 1.0 Content-Type: text/plain X-Spam-Status: No, score=-8.0 required=5.0 tests=BAYES_00,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,FREEMAIL_ENVFROM_END_DIGIT,FREEMAIL_FROM,GIT_PATCH_0,RCVD_IN_DNSWL_NONE,SPF_HELO_NONE,SPF_PASS,TXREP aut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: Christophe Lyon writes: > This rule was missing, and 'make install-html' was failing. > It is copied from the corresponding one in fortran. > > 2024-03-29 Christophe Lyon > > gcc/m2/ > * Make-lang.in (install-html): New rule. > --- > gcc/m2/Make-lang.in | 19 +++++++++++++++++++ > 1 file changed, 19 insertions(+) > > diff --git a/gcc/m2/Make-lang.in b/gcc/m2/Make-lang.in > index ef6990ce617..2d8a47a1b1f 100644 > --- a/gcc/m2/Make-lang.in > +++ b/gcc/m2/Make-lang.in > @@ -206,6 +206,25 @@ $(build_htmldir)/m2/index.html: $(TEXISRC) $(objdir)/m2/images/gnu.eps > rm -f $(@D)/* > $(TEXI2HTML) -I $(objdir)/m2 -I $(srcdir)/m2 -I $(gcc_docdir)/include -o $(@D) $< > > +M2_HTMLFILES = $(build_htmldir)/m2 > + > +m2.install-html: $(M2_HTMLFILES) > + @$(NORMAL_INSTALL) > + test -z "$(htmldir)" || $(mkinstalldirs) "$(DESTDIR)$(htmldir)" > + @list='$(M2_HTMLFILES)'; for p in $$list; do \ > + if test -f "$$p" || test -d "$$p"; then d=""; else d="$(srcdir)/"; fi; \ > + f=$(html__strip_dir) \ > + if test -d "$$d$$p"; then \ > + echo " $(mkinstalldirs) '$(DESTDIR)$(htmldir)/$$f'"; \ > + $(mkinstalldirs) "$(DESTDIR)$(htmldir)/$$f" || exit 1; \ > + echo " $(INSTALL_DATA) '$$d$$p'/* '$(DESTDIR)$(htmldir)/$$f'"; \ > + $(INSTALL_DATA) "$$d$$p"/* "$(DESTDIR)$(htmldir)/$$f"; \ > + else \ > + echo " $(INSTALL_DATA) '$$d$$p' '$(DESTDIR)$(htmldir)/$$f'"; \ > + $(INSTALL_DATA) "$$d$$p" "$(DESTDIR)$(htmldir)/$$f"; \ > + fi; \ > + done > + > # gm2-libs.texi > > m2/gm2-libs.texi: gm2-libs.texi-check; @true lgtm, many thanks for the fix, regards, Gaius